  8. Fluvirin is an immunization against influenza (“the flu”) for people over 4 years old. It is an inactivated trivalent vaccine against 3 types of flu viruses. Fluvirin was initially approved in the United States in 1988. It is currently made by Seqirus Inc. using an egg-based process.
